WebPhosphine gas may react with certain metals and cause corrosion, especially at higher temperatures and relative humidity. Metals such as brass, copper and other copper alloys and precious metals are susceptible to ... 0.4 mg/m3 (TWA) ACGIH (TLV): 1 ppm (STEL) 0.3 ppm (TWA) OSHA (PEL): Other Value: Not established 5000 ppm (TWA) 9000 mg/m3 …

WebNov 7, 2024 · Long term, repeated exposure to phosphine may cause: anaemia bronchitis gastrointestinal disorders speech and motor disturbances weakness weight loss spontaneous fractures swelling to your jaw, tooth ache and jawbone necrosis (never open tablet packets with your teeth). WebJan 25, 2024 · Phosphine is an insecticide for the fumigation of grains, animal feed, and leaf-stored tobacco, and it was used as a rodenticide in bulk grain stores. Phosphine poisoning may occur after accidental inhalation of phosphine, sometimes leading to death. WebPhosphine or hydrogen phosphide (PH3) is a low molecular weight, low boiling point compound that diffuses rapidly and penetrates deeply into materials, such as large bulks of grain or tightly packed materials.
